The CRA is rewriting the rules of selling software.

After 2027, anything sold in Europe must meet strict security standards. This will reshape how we build, patch, and monetize software, and how we work with open source.

I spoke with Mike Milinkovich of the Eclipse Foundation to learn more.

Our problem is that the veracity of Stack Overflow as source data is increasingly questionable.

Tags for the top 20 programming languages in the last period were roughly 10% of the volume of questions at Stack Overflow's peak.

Our analysis dates back to 2012. We correlate cumulative language usage as seen through non-forked PRs on public GitHub repos against questions asked on Stack Overflow.

It's an incomplete story, but gives us a pulse on language traction using publicly available data.
